Summary
Sinonasal osteoblastoma, a rare benign tumor, can occur in the nasal cavity. Endoscopic removal is effective, and clinicians should consider osteoblastoma in differential diagnoses.
Area of Science:
- Otolaryngology
- Pathology
Background:
- Sinonasal osteoblastoma is an exceptionally rare benign bone-forming tumor.
- These tumors typically present in the nasal cavity.
